Overview of the Oxford Advanced Learner's Dictionary

The OALD is a comprehensive dictionary designed for advanced learners of English. It provides detailed explanations of words, phrases, and idioms, along with examples of usage, grammar, and pronunciation guidance. The dictionary has a long history, dating back to 1948, and has undergone numerous revisions to keep pace with the evolving English language.

3. Longman Dictionary of Contemporary English (LDOCE Online)

Longman was the first to introduce the "3000 most frequent words" concept. Their online interface is dated, but their definitions are shockingly clear. LDOCE is excellent for learners who struggle with Oxford's more academic tone.

The Object of Desire: What is the OALD 11th Edition?

Released in 2024 (with the 10th edition arriving around 2020), the Oxford Advanced Learner’s Dictionary 11th Edition is the latest iteration of a legacy that began in 1948 with A.S. Hornby. It is not a simple word list. It is a pedagogical ecosystem.

Key features of the genuine 11th edition include:

The app version (Oxford Advanced Learner’s Dictionary, 11th edition) costs roughly $30–40 USD for a 12-month premium subscription, or a one-time purchase of around $60 for perpetual access on a single platform. The physical hardcover is about $55–$70.

Why does it cost that much? Because Oxford University Press employs lexicographers, linguists, corpus analysts, AI engineers, audio engineers, and software developers for three years between editions. You aren’t buying paper; you’re buying curation.
